| Abstract | Analysis of changing of sediment transport is very vital in estuary projects, such
as development and management of navigation, port and harbours, environment
management, etc. For the Chao Phraya river mouth in Thailand, this problem has been
investigated by NED ECO, and AIT.
This study is aimed to analysis the change in hydraulic regime of the Chao Phraya
river. A hydrodynamic model, RCPW A VE model, sediment transport model are used to
analysis the changing of sediment transport problem along the navigation channel in
Chao Phraya Estuary with various river concentrations, and wave parameters. The grid
system of .1x = .1y = 50 m, which covers a computation domain of 42 km2 is used for all
three model above. A time increment of 60 seconds is used for mud transport models.
The results of hydrodynamic model as wave height, wave induced current and
result of sediment transport model are used for analysis change in hydraulic regime of the
Chao Phraya river. Based on the results and the data collection in the upstream station at
Nakhon Sawwan from 1956 to 1993, two sets of sediment concentrations are obtained for
the past and present conditions and used as sediment transports from the river mouth in
computing siltation in the past and present conditions. |
